Enterrado/a en: Altdorf, Swabia (now Switzerland) Padre de Eticho von Augsburg, bishop; Guelph II von Bayern; Guelph III Herzog von Bayern and Rudolf II, count of Altdorf Hermano de: Eticho II, Graf von Schwaben; Bishop Konrad of Konstanz and Herzog Wolfrat I von Alshausen http://fmg.ac/Projects/MedLands/WURTTEMBERG.htm#RudolfIIAltdorfMItaOehningenA RUDOLF (- ----, bur Altdorf). The Historia Welforum names (in order) "sanctum Counradum Constanciensem episcopum, Etichonem et Roudolfum" as the three sons of "Heinricus" & his wife[819]. The Annalista Saxo names (in order) "tres fratres Rodulfus, Eticho, qui et Welphus, et Conradus; qui tempore Heinrici regis, patris Ottonis Magni extiterunt"[820]. The Genealogia Welforum names (in order) "sanctum Chunradum Constantinensem episcopum, Etichonem et Rudolfem" as children of "Heinricum" & his wife[821]. 935. m --- (bur Altdorf). The primary source which confirms her marriage has not yet been identified. Rudolf & his wife had [two] children: i) [RUDOLF (-10 Mar ----, bur Altdorf).] ii) [822] ETICHO (-988). Bishop of Augsburg.
